The aim of the plan is to place the whole of Poland's resources at the service of the German war machine without the slightest re- gard for the needs of the Poles either now or the future.

The preamble says that no long-range economic policy can be conducted in Poland. On the contrary, it is necessary to con duct the economic fe of that $211.area 50 that at the shortest notice it can achieve the maximum

for service

strengthening

the Retch war economy.

Wages Of Labourera Etc-In- creamed cost Of Living "(File No. 10) The Report dtd Recommenda tions of the Sub-Committee ap pointed to investigate the to- cidence of additional cost of UV- ing for artisans, labourers eta, was considered.

It was decided to circulate the Report among all Members of the Chamber and also furnish copies to Government, The North Borneo Planters Association and the Chinese Chamber of Com- merce. The Secretary was in- structed to mention that there
